WebThe economy of Liberia is extremely underdeveloped, with only $3.222 billion by gross domestic product as of 2024, largely due to the First (1989–1996) and Second Liberian Civil War (1999–2003). Liberia itself is one of the poorest and least developed countries in the world, according to the United Nations..
